Position Summary

The scientist is responsible for downstream purification development activities related to the production of bioproduct active pharmaceutical ingredients including purification process definition and optimization, process robustness studies, process transfers to pilot plant and manufacturing sites and authorship of downstream process development sections of regulatory submissions. The incumbent will interact closely with other scientists in Bioprocess/Bioproduct Development as well as Discovery, Technical services for Manufacturing, and Manufacturing scientists. They are expected to be an integral participant on multidisciplinary CMC project teams that provide support for bioproduct process and product development activities.
